Land tax is payable on every acre or part of an acre of land in the territory. House tax is payable on the assessed value of every house in the territory. The combined (Land and House) tax, referred to as Property Tax, is charged to every owner who erects, reconstructs, enlarges or repairs any existing building.
On the 29th of October 2008, the governments of the United Kingdom and the British Virgin Islands (BVI) signed two pivotal agreements, namely, the Tax Information Exchange Agreement and the Double Taxation Agreement. These agreements came into force on the 12th of April 2010.
US Virgin Islands is not a tax haven or offshore jurisdiction, but USVI companies (or corporations) could be established as "USVI Exempt Companies" with partial or full exemption from local and US federal income taxes.
As a territory, the U.S. Congress is empowered to "make all needful Rules and Regulations respecting" the USVI. As far as taxes go, Congress requires that the USVI impose an income tax that "mirrors" the U.S. federal income tax found in United States Code, Title 26 (also known as the "Internal Revenue Code" or "IRC").

The Canada-BVI Tax Information Exchange Agreement ("TIEA") came into force on 11 March 2014. The TIEA was signed in May 2013, and the effective date provisions are set out in Article 13 of the Agreement. The BVI is now party to 25 TIEAs.
